summ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Tavis Ormandy <taviso@gentoo.org>2003-09-08 13:08:21 +0000
committerTavis Ormandy <taviso@gentoo.org>2003-09-08 13:08:21 +0000
commita8d012f96b84cfef9a74953fdf3ca83be98cc315 (patch)
tree457e09e08b3b2714dc55558af526a5089fbcdf7f /app-editors
parentminor updates (diff)
downloadgentoo-2-a8d012f96b84cfef9a74953fdf3ca83be98cc315.tar.gz
gentoo-2-a8d012f96b84cfef9a74953fdf3ca83be98cc315.tar.bz2
gentoo-2-a8d012f96b84cfef9a74953fdf3ca83be98cc315.zip
minor updates
Diffstat (limited to 'app-editors')
-rw-r--r--app-editors/teco/ChangeLog12
-rw-r--r--app-editors/teco/Manifest6
-rw-r--r--app-editors/teco/files/digest-teco-1.00-r15
-rw-r--r--app-editors/teco/files/digest-teco-1.00-r25
-rw-r--r--app-editors/teco/teco-1.00-r2.ebuild (renamed from app-editors/teco/teco-1.00-r1.ebuild)30
5 files changed, 33 insertions, 25 deletions
diff --git a/app-editors/teco/ChangeLog b/app-editors/teco/ChangeLog
index 50fddf808530..ad79a17474a8 100644
--- a/app-editors/teco/ChangeLog
+++ b/app-editors/teco/ChangeLog
@@ -1,6 +1,16 @@
# ChangeLog for app-editors/teco
# Copyright 2000-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-editors/teco/ChangeLog,v 1.6 2003/06/29 18:24:09 aliz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-editors/teco/ChangeLog,v 1.7 2003/09/08 13:08:17 taviso Exp $
+
+*teco-1.00-r2 (08 Sep 2003)
+
+ 08 Sep 2003; Tavis Ormandy <taviso@gentoo.org> teco-1.00-r1.ebuild,
+ teco-1.00-r2.ebuild:
+ provide virtual/editor
+ gzipping optional documentation to save bandwidth.
+ added documentation archive to HOMEPAGE.
+ minor syntax changes.
+ make repoman whitespace checker happy.
*teco-1.00-r1 (18 Jun 2003)
diff --git a/app-editors/teco/Manifest b/app-editors/teco/Manifest
index 6271aaed1c56..4c5c2ebf5f24 100644
--- a/app-editors/teco/Manifest
+++ b/app-editors/teco/Manifest
@@ -1,6 +1,4 @@
-MD5 2090ac333df1975f7601f08673e047c7 teco-1.00-r1.ebuild 1525
-MD5 ab0d7e942481c77ea1505df60645e430 teco-1.00-r2.ebuild 1313
-MD5 4d3e95bca7a72811e26cd6bb14a3034a ChangeLog 789
+MD5 7fad5f04eb2e7ce7a09352f8e79a6f17 teco-1.00-r2.ebuild 1342
+MD5 266f6a74f044d45254f0944df682eb7f ChangeLog 1100
MD5 7510851e62ed9c830d82a0e6d068052a metadata.xml 1324
-MD5 8b57d774afe4775a6ffa845c0e1712d0 files/digest-teco-1.00-r1 271
MD5 cbaebc6d51eb71e4aaaea9737b9d88f6 files/digest-teco-1.00-r2 282
diff --git a/app-editors/teco/files/digest-teco-1.00-r1 b/app-editors/teco/files/digest-teco-1.00-r1
deleted file mode 100644
index c3f03d2dd4ba..000000000000
--- a/app-editors/teco/files/digest-teco-1.00-r1
+++ /dev/null
@@ -1,5 +0,0 @@
-MD5 b996a43a133f0d636ef3331da2374e6e teco.tar.gz 61305
-MD5 a62525bfb67118350690e093c4ed58cf tecolore.txt 15533
-MD5 ad5f4f568bbe6fcb951070dc997cc020 tech.txt 3904
-MD5 d5efa795e45b895c6e1fd861cc8f1aae teco.doc 498722
-MD5 46ec1e080831bed18f18c9d2c336aa3e tecoprog.doc 43989
diff --git a/app-editors/teco/files/digest-teco-1.00-r2 b/app-editors/teco/files/digest-teco-1.00-r2
new file mode 100644
index 000000000000..74b1289dfae3
--- /dev/null
+++ b/app-editors/teco/files/digest-teco-1.00-r2
@@ -0,0 +1,5 @@
+MD5 b996a43a133f0d636ef3331da2374e6e teco.tar.gz 61305
+MD5 843cb3087703e06bf984b1c82f48b1f8 tecolore.txt.gz 7039
+MD5 cd83ff9d990cba30020647c58cba1fa3 tech.txt.gz 1971
+MD5 37dd19fce3555c89d64b90bdca4d52c8 teco.doc.gz 129896
+MD5 5a805d3e329fc5e99fa7e1ae37e9dcfb tecoprog.doc.gz 15629
diff --git a/app-editors/teco/teco-1.00-r1.ebuild b/app-editors/teco/teco-1.00-r2.ebuild
index 6377766b41ed..89c19f181ab2 100644
--- a/app-editors/teco/teco-1.00-r1.ebuild
+++ b/app-editors/teco/teco-1.00-r2.ebuild
@@ -1,47 +1,47 @@
# Copyright 1999-2003 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-editors/teco/teco-1.00-r1.ebuild,v 1.4 2003/09/05 23:05:05 msterret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-editors/teco/teco-1.00-r2.ebuild,v 1.1 2003/09/08 13:08:17 taviso Exp $
+
+inherit ccc
DESCRIPTION="Classic TECO editor, Predecessor to EMACS."
-HOMEPAGE="http://www.ibiblio.org/pub/linux/apps/editors/tty/"
+HOMEPAGE="http://www.ibiblio.org/pub/linux/apps/editors/tty/ http://www.ibiblio.org/pub/academic/computer-science/history/pdp-11/teco"
SRC_URI="http://www.ibiblio.org/pub/linux/apps/editors/tty/teco.tar.gz
- doc? ( http://www.ibiblio.org/pub/academic/computer-science/history/pdp-11/teco/doc/tecolore.txt
- http://www.ibiblio.org/pub/academic/computer-science/history/pdp-11/teco/doc/tech.txt
- http://www.ibiblio.org/pub/academic/computer-science/history/pdp-11/teco/doc/teco.doc
- http://www.ibiblio.org/pub/academic/computer-science/history/pdp-11/teco/doc/tecoprog.doc )"
+ doc? ( mirror://gentoo/tecolore.txt.gz
+ mirror://gentoo/tech.txt.gz
+ mirror://gentoo/teco.doc.gz
+ mirror://gentoo/tecoprog.doc.gz )"
LICENSE="freedist"
+
SLOT="0"
KEYWORDS="alpha x86"
IUSE="doc"
+
DEPEND="virtual/glibc
sys-libs/libtermcap-compat
>=sys-apps/sed-4"
RDEPEND="virtual/glibc
sys-libs/libtermcap-compat"
-
-inherit ccc
+PROVIDE="virtual/editor"
S=${WORKDIR}
-src_unpack() {
- unpack teco.tar.gz || die "sorry, couldnt unpack teco."
-}
-
src_compile() {
+ # Remove hardcoded compiler and CFLAGS
sed -i 's/CFLAGS = -O//' Makefile
- is-ccc && replace-cc-hardcode
+ replace-cc-hardcode
emake || die "compilation failed"
echo
- size te
+ size te; ls -l te
echo
}
src_install() {
dobin te
dodoc sample.tecorc sample.tecorc2 READ.ME MANIFEST
- use doc && dodoc ${DISTDIR}/{tecolore.txt,tech.txt,teco.doc,tecoprog.doc}
+ use doc && dodoc tecolore.txt tech.txt teco.doc tecoprog.doc
doman te.1
}